Build Your Own: Dealers Design Last Batch of Special-Edition 2010 Dodge Viper

Dodge has had no trouble crafting its own special-edition models to celebrate the end of the 2010 Viper's production run, but it's now opening the fun to select dealerships as well.

Dealers who managed to sell high volumes of Dodge's two-seat sports car have been awarded the chance to design their own special-edition cars. For the most part, the custom Vipers are relegated to special paint schemes for the SRT10 roadster, the SRT10 coupe, and the SRT10 ACR coupe.


Thus far, Chrysler's revealed three examples of the dealer-custom program. The snake crafted by Woodhouse Dodge in Blair, Nebraska, is perhaps most unique -- the yellow Viper breaks from tradition and applies many of the unique touches found on the Viper ACR coupe to a drop-top roadster. Tromball Dodge created the "Reverse SRT10 ACR," which inverts the color combination used earlier this year on the Snakeskin Green Special Edition. Roanoke Dodge in Roanoke, Illinois, chose to apply dual Plum Crazy racing stripes on a black SRT10 coupe.

As is the case with the umpteen other special-edition Vipers we've seen this year, production of the Dealer Exclusive Program cars will be limited to 50 in total -- roughly ten percent of the entire 2010 Viper production run.

Subaru Launches Impreza WRX STI Spec C for Japanese Market


We wouldn’t exactly call Subaru’s WRX STI “soft,” but the Japanese automaker has just launched the WRX STI Spec C--a performance-tuned variant exclusively for the Japanese market.

Sure, the Spec C still uses the same 2.0-liter turbocharged boxer-four underhood, but engineers made a few small tweaks to boost performance. A redesigned turbocharger, along with a re-mapped engine computer, are said to help reduce turbo lag and improve the car’s top-end. The STI Spec C also receives an intercooler water injector, allowing intake air to remain cool, even at speed.

In the twisties, drivers will likely notice tighter steering and less body roll, thanks in part to a reinforced front suspension crossmember, stiffer coil springs, and unique rear sub-frame bushings. Subaru also replaced the rear differential with a Torsion-type unit, designed to enhance traction in corners.


If that weren’t enough, engineers put the STI on a crash diet. The Spec C gains an aluminum hood, laminate side windows, a smaller battery, and loses a spare tire in the name of saving weight. Subaru also developed a new set of 18-inch aluminum wheels (shod in Bridgetson Potenza RE070 rubber) said to further reduce unsprung weight.
If this sounds like your dream Impreza, rest assured it will remain that way. Only 900 examples will be built, and unless you’re living in Japan, it won’t be sold in your neck of the woods.

Lamborghini Navarra Concept Study Penned by Lockheed Martin Designer

Most young designers these days appear to have the hots for anything related to Lamborghini. After the Cnossus, Minotauro, Miura Nuovo, Conquisto, Furia and Toro LA690-4 - just to mention some of the Lamborghini design concepts we've shown you the past few months, here comes yet another proposal for a Raging Bull model, this time from American Adam Denning who happens to be a designer for Lockheed Martin USA.
The Navarra is design study for a flagship Lamborghini supercar to replace the current Murcielago model.

"I tried to imagine all the V12 flagships of the brand from the Miura to the Murcielago, and then create a car that would look like it not only belonged in this group, but that it was the result of these cars as well," Denning explains.



"I was very inspired by Michelangelo's La Pietà. The way Mary's garments flow down and fold over each other was the main inspiration for the Navarra's overlapping surfaces and organic shapes."

Denning, who has a masters in Automotive Design from the Scuola Politecnica di Design in Milan, Italy, says that the Navarra would make use of a carbon-fiber frame and carbon-fiber panels with power coming from a V12 engine.

Next-Gen Mercedes-Benz B-class Could Spawn SUV, Sedan Variants for U.S. Market

Next-Gen Mercedes-Benz B-class Could Spawn SUV, Sedan Variants for U.S. Market
Mercedes-Benz has previously toyed with the notion of bringing its compact B-class range to the United States, but new reports suggest at least two different models could ultimately arrive in our market.

According to Automotive News, M-B marketing chief Joachim Schmidt says the new B-class range will have no less than four variants, and two -- an SUV and hatchback -- are likely to make the trip across the pond. A sedan model is also in the works, and it too could ultimately wind up in America.

Although Mercedes-Benz plans on launching the new B-class range in Europe by the end of next year, the timing of a U.S. launch is uncertain. Schmidt cited the fluxing exchange rate as one hurdle, but also noted that -- as is often the case with small cars -- the business case rests with fuel costs in the U.S.

“The behavior of Americans depends on fuel prices,” Schmidt said, noting his group has seen U.S. consumers move backed towards light trucks. “Nevertheless, we also see a trend towards fuel-efficient cars.”

Even if Mercedes decides to withhold the B-class from our market, it may still come to North America for the Canadian market. The compact five-door hatchback has been offered in Canada since 2005.

Spyker to Begin Selling Sports Cars at Saab Showrooms

In a move that won't surprise anyone in the automotive industry, Spyker Cars NV and Saab Automobile owner, Victor Muller, confirmed plans to sell Spyker's high-end sports cars through Saab retailers by the end of the year.

"We are signing up Spyker dealerships left, right and center," Muller said in an interview with the Bloomberg news agency at Saab's headquarters in Trollhaettan, Sweden.
The firm's CEO said that as Saab dealers open their doors, Spyker's dealer network will almost double in 2010 expanding from 35 to 60 outlets and to about 90 by the end of next year.



One of the first Spyker models to be sold through selected Saab outlets will be the C8 Aileron that can reach a top speed of 186mph or 300km/h, and carries a base price of $214,990 in the U.S.

Aside from the Swedish automaker's dealer network, Muller said that Spyker has also started to benefit from lower prices for "generic" parts such as windscreen wiper motors that Saab gets through its higher sales volumes, adding that Spyker also plans to "tap Saab's engineering resources".

"Spyker will be profitable in its own right, very much helped by its sister Saab," said Muller. "It's wonderful that the company that saved Saab is also benefiting from having done that in its own business."

General Motors Garners Nearly $9 Million in Ads with MLB Corvette Giveaway

Earlier this week, we posted how General Motors offered a brand-new 2011 Chevrolet Corvette convertible to Detroit Tiger pitcher Armando Galarraga for his near perfect game against the Cleveland Indians. That generosity may have been a near $9 million win for GM as well.


According to Joyce Julius & Associates Inc., which measures and analyzes the impact of sponsorship on all forms of media from print to television to the Internet, General Motors’ giveaway to Galarraga generated nearly $1 million in exposure in over 700 television programs and nearly $8 million in over 150,000 publications, Internet articles and posts. Note that the automaker never requested or commissioned the study.

“We were not contracted to do the study,” Eric Wright, Joyce Julius' vice president of research and product development, said in an e-mail to Crain's Detroit Business, an affiliate of Automotive News. “We often look at national level happenings in sponsorship and provide that information to all of our clients and the media.”
